I think a smaller bike would be better until you get some practice but CC size is not what you should look at. Overall and weight distribution is more important, and it also depends on your size. If you are taller then it will be better. Lots of good points about cruisers and the virago all good choices. May be a good way to go for a year or two. Welcome and good luck with your choice Brad

2006 Venture electrical problem
BradT replied to Sylvester's topic in Royal Star Venture Tech Talk ('99 - '13)
Four battery's in five years ? Not sure what you are using or the driving habits. Some batterys need to be charged properly from day one. If not the life could be shortened. Also if the bike is used for frequent short trips to the store or work, only a few miles away, the battery never gets charged properly. It needs to be fully charged once in a while, if not by the end of the season it could be toast. Brad -
